/* CSS Document */
@import url(default.css);
body{font-size:12px; background:#FFFFFF;}
.wrapper{width:960px; margin:0 auto; background:#F2F1D7;}
.head{width:100%; background:url() center top no-repeat;}
.head .olympic-link{width:100%; height:40px;}
.head .olympic-link a{width:100%; height:40px; display:block; text-indent:-1000em; overflow:hidden;}
.head .nav-cart{width:100%; height:28px; background:url(/images/www/bbs/assets1/nav-cart_bg.gif) left center repeat-x; color:#333333;}
.head .nav-cart li{display:inline; line-height:26px; padding:0 5px;}
.head .nav-cart .login-link{float:left;}
.head .nav-cart .login-link a{color:#666666;}
.head .nav-cart .nav-link{float:right;}
.head .nav-cart .nav-link a{color:#333333;}
.head .logo-topAds{width:100%; background:#FFF;}
.head .logo-topAds .logo{width:265px; height:87px; background:url(/images/www/bbs/assets1/logo.gif) no-repeat; margin:6px 2px; float:left;}
.head .logo-topAds .logo a{text-indent:-1000em; width:265px; height:87px; display:block; overflow:hidden;}
.head .logo-topAds .topAds{float:right; width:680px; height:83px; background:url(/images/www/bbs/advs/topad.gif) no-repeat; margin:6px 3px;}
.head .logo-topAds .topAds a{text-indent:-1000em; width:680px; height:83px; display:block; overflow:hidden; float:right;}

.main{margin:5px auto;}
.main .hot-txt{border:1px solid #eeeeee; margin-bottom:5px; display:block;}
.main .hot-txt li{float:left; display:block; width:190px; padding:0px 0px 5px 1px; color:#333333; height:1em; overflow:hidden; background-color:#FFFFFF}
.main .hot-txt li a{color:#333333;}
.main .m_3_1{float:left; width:340px;}
.main .m_3_2{float:left; margin:0 5px; width:350px;}
.main .m_3_3{float:right; width:260px;}

.main .box-gray{border:1px solid #F0DAD2;zoom:1;}
.main .box-gray dt{background:url(/images/www/bbs/assets1/cat_topic_bg.gif) repeat-x; height:26px;zoom:1;}
.main .box-gray dt .title{float:left; font:12px/24px Verdana, Arial, Helvetica, sans-serif; color:#333333; background:url(/images/www/bbs/assets1/cat_topic_mbg.gif) left center no-repeat; width:77px; height:26px; text-align:center;zoom:1;}
.main .box-gray dt .more{float:right; color:#333333; line-height:24px; padding-right:8px;zoom:1;} 
.main .box-gray dt .more a{color:#333333;zoom:1;}
.main .box-gray dt .more a:hover{text-decoration:underline;zoom:1;}
.main .box-gray .cnt{padding:1px;zoom:1;}
.main .box-gray .cnt .imgs{width:120px; float:left; text-align:center;zoom:1;}
.main .box-gray .cnt .imgs img{width:110px; height:70px; text-align:center;zoom:1;}
.main .box-gray .cnt .imgs .img-name{ background:#FFF; width:110px; padding:3px 0; text-align:center; color:#13A3F3; margin:3px auto;zoom:1;}
.main .box-gray .cnt .imgs .summary{color:#333333; line-height:1.5em; text-align:left; height:70px; overflow:hidden;zoom:1;}
.main .box-gray .cnt .imgs .summary a{text-decoration:none; color:#333333;zoom:1;}
.main .box-gray .cnt .imgs .summary a:hover{text-decoration:underline;color:#FB4202;zoom:1;}
.main .box-gray .cnt .com_list{margin-left:5px; float:left; width:auto;zoom:1;}
.main .box-gray .cnt .com_list li{line-height:1.7em;zoom:1;}
.main .box-gray .cnt .com_list .catID{width:40px; float:left;zoom:1;}
.main .box-gray .cnt .com_list .catID a{color:#014BAF;zoom:1;}
.main .box-gray .cnt .com_list .catID a:hover{text-decoration:underline;zoom:1;}
.main .box-gray .cnt .com_list .title{width:99%; float:left;zoom:1;}
.main .box-gray .cnt .com_list .title a{color:#333333;zoom:1;}
.main .box-gray .cnt .com_list .title a:hover{text-decoration:underline;zoom:1;}

.main .t2{padding:0 3px;}
.main .t2 li{float:left; width:97%;}
.main .t2{
	PADDING-RIGHT: 0px; FONT-WEIGHT: normal; FONT-SIZE: 12px; PADDING-BOTTOM: 0px; PADDING-TOP: 5px; HEIGHT: 18px; TEXT-ALIGN: left
}
.main .t2 A:link {
	COLOR: #333333
}
.main .t2 A:visited {
	COLOR: #333333
}
.main .t2 A:hover {
	text-decoration:underline;
	COLOR: #FF0000
}

.main .box-blue{border:1px solid #F0DAD2;zoom:1;background:#FFF;}
.main .box-blue dt{background:url(/images/www/bbs/assets1/r_topic_bg.gif) repeat-x; height:26px;zoom:1;}
.main .box-blue dt .title{float:left; font:12px/24px Verdana, Arial, Helvetica, sans-serif; color:#333333;zoom:1;}
.main .box-blue dt .more{float:right; color:#333333; line-height:24px; padding-right:8px;zoom:1;} 
.main .box-blue dt .more a{color:#333333;zoom:1;}
.main .box-blue dt .more a:hover{text-decoration:underline;zoom:1;}
.yellow{color:#FFFF00;}
.red{color:#FF0000;}
.bold{font-weight:bold;}
a:hover{text-decoration:underline;}
.main .headLine ul{padding:5px;}
.main .headLine ul li{line-height:26px;font-size:14px;color:#333333;}
.main .headLine ul li a{font-size:14px;color:#333333;}
.main .headLine ul li a:hover{text-decoration:underline;}
.main .headLine ul li a.sort{color:#0267A1;}
.main .headLine{font-size:14px;}
.main .headLine li{font-size:14px;line-height:24px;}
.main .zh-list{padding:0 1px}
.main .zh-list li{float:left; width:50%; display:block; white-space:nowrap; overflow:hidden; text-overflow:ellipsis;}
.main .zh-list li a{left center no-repeat; color:#333333; padding-left:0px; line-height:17px;}
.main .tp-list{padding:0 1px;}
.main .tp-list li{float:left; width:50%; display:block; white-space:nowrap; overflow:hidden; text-overflow:ellipsis;}
.main .tp-list li a{left center no-repeat; color:#333333; padding-left:0px; line-height:0em;}
.main .news-list{padding:1px;}
.main .news-list li a{color:#333333;}
.main .news-list li a:hover{text-decoration:underline;zoom:1;}
.main .pop1{ border-bottom:1px dashed #CCCCCC; padding-bottom:5px;}
.main .pop1 .pic{float:left; margin-right:5px;}
.main .pop1 .title{float:left; font:bold 12px Verdana, Arial, Helvetica, sans-serif; width:68%;color:#333333;}
.main .pop1 .title a{color:#ff0000; font:bold 12px Verdana, Arial, Helvetica, sans-serif; text-decoration:none;color:#333333;}
.main .pop1 .summary{float:left; width:68%; color:#888888; line-height:1.5em; font-size:12px; height:52px; overflow:hidden;}
.main .pop1 a:hover{text-decoration:underline;zoom:0;}
.main .headLine .catID1{float:left; width:70px;}
.main .headLine .catID1 a{color:#0267A1;}
.main li .catID{float:left; width:55px;}
.main li .catID a{color:#0267A1;}
.main li .title{float:left; width:98%; padding-top:0; _padding-top:2px; white-space:nowrap; overflow:hidden; text-overflow:ellipsis;}
.main li .title a{color:#333333;}
.main .column{}
.main .column li.list{line-height:1.75em; width:135px; float:left;}
.main .column .clm_2_1{float:left; width:49%; text-align:left;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.main .column .clm_2_2{float:right; width:49%; text-align:left;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.main .column a{color:#0367A2; text-decoration:none;}
.main .column a:hover{text-decoration:underline; color:#FF0000;}
.main .web-rule a{color:#0367A2; text-decoration:none;}
.main .web-rule a:hover{text-decoration:underline; color:#FF0000;}
.main .gy{width:100%; height:60px; overflow:hidden; margin:5px auto; text-align:center; background-color:#FFFFFF}
.main .gy2{width:100%; height:70px; overflow:hidden; margin:5px auto; text-align:center;}
.main .gy3{width:100%; height:90px; overflow:hidden; margin:5px auto; text-align:center;}
.main .ads{width:100%; height:285px; overflow:hidden; margin:5px auto; text-align:center;}
.main .advs{width:100%; overflow:hidden; margin:5px auto; text-align:center;}
.main .LH2{line-height:1.69em; _line-height:1.75em;background:#FFF;}
.main .splitH5{width:98%; height:5px; overflow:hidden;}
.main .prod-list{}
.main .prod-list li{width:138px; text-align:center; float:left;}
.main .prod-list .img img{width:100px; height:100px;}
.main .prod-list .name a{color:#333333;}
.fm{border:1px solid #CCCCCC;}
.fm ul{height:65px;}
.fm ul li{float:left;}
.fm ul .left{height:90px;width:41px;background:url(/images/www/bbs/assets1/activeleft.gif);}
.fm2{border:1px solid #CCCCCC;}
.fm2 ul{height:95px;}
.main .tj-list{padding:0 1px;}
.main .tj-list li{float:left; width:50%; display:block; white-space:nowrap; overflow:hidden; text-overflow:ellipsis;}

.main .job-list{padding:0 1px;}
.main .job-list li{float:left; width:20%; background-color:#FFFFFF}
.main .job-list li a{background:url(/images/www/bbs/assets1/job.gif) left center no-repeat; color:#333333; padding-left:50px; line-height:1.8em;}
.main .job-list a:hover{text-decoration:underline;zoom:0;}
.main .job2-list{padding:0 1px;}
.main .job2-list li{float:left; width:20%; background-color:#FFFFFF}
.main .job2-list li a{background:url(/images/www/bbs/assets1/job2.gif) left center no-repeat; color:#333333; padding-left:50px; line-height:1.8em;}
.main .job2-list a:hover{text-decoration:underline;zoom:0;}
.main .x-list{padding:0 1px;}
.main .x-list li{float:left; width:20%;}
.main .x-list li a{left center no-repeat; color:#333333; padding-left:0px; line-height:1.8em;}
.main .x-list a:hover{text-decoration:underline;zoom:0;}
.main .sm-list{padding:0 1px;}
.main .sm-list li{float:left; width:50%; display:block; white-space:nowrap; overflow:hidden; text-overflow:ellipsis;}
.main .sm-list li a{left center no-repeat; color:#333333; padding-left:0px; line-height:1.8em;}
.main .jy-list{padding:0 1px;}
.main .jy-list li{float:left; width:33%; display:block; white-space:nowrap; overflow:hidden; text-overflow:ellipsis;}
.main .jy-list li a{left center no-repeat; color:#333333; padding-left:0px; line-height:1.8em;}
/*.main .link-white a{color:#FFF;}
.white{color:#FFF;}*/
.foot{text-align:center; line-height:2em; background-color:#FFFFFF}
.foot li{display:inline; padding:5px 10px;}
.foot li a{color:#333333;}
.hid{display:none;}

.ft {width:15px;height:15px;border:#d3d4d6 1px solid;font-size:11px;font-family: Arial;text-align:center;float:left;}
.itemOn {cursor:default;background:#f40003;}
.itemOff {cursor:pointer;background:#fff;}
#slideTitle{font-weight:bold; white-space:nowrap; overflow:hidden; text-overflow:ellipsis; width:280px;}
#slideDesc{white-space:nowrap; overflow:hidden; text-overflow:ellipsis; width:240px; display:block; float:left;} 
.imginfolist {overflow: hidden; *height: 1%; padding:13px 5px 13px 5px; margin:0; width:260px; +width:auto; _width:auto; position:relative; left:-100px; +left:0; _left:0;}
			.imginfolist li { float: left; list-style: none; width: 56px; margin: 0 3px 8px 0; text-align:center; overflow:hidden;}
			.imginfolist li a { padding: 1px; display: block; border: 1px solid {BORDERCOLOR};  text-align:center;}
			.imginfolist li p { text-align: center; height: 24px; color: {TEXT}; overflow: hidden;  text-align:center; text-indent:0;}
			.imginfolist li p a { border: none;  text-align:center; text-indent:0; color:#333333;}
			.s{
   width:270px;
                                 white-space: nowrap;
                                 display :block;
   overflow : hidden;
   text-overflow : ellipsis ;
   word-break:keep-all;
}
.zhonghe{background:url(/images/www/bbs/assets1/b1_bg.gif) left top repeat-x; height:291px; _height:307px; overflow:hidden;}
div.HackBox {
  background-image:url(/images/www/bbs/mall/mallindex/dh_bg.gif);
  padding : 9px 8px ;
  border-left: 0px solid #6697CD;
  border-right: 0px solid #6697CD;
  border-bottom: 0px solid #6697CD;
}